# 2023.08.21更新日志
# 🍏 新功能
新增学生结课明细表逻辑优化
统计维度改变:学生结课明细表从签约维度改为从学生维度出发去统计
菜单权限变动:教务保留学生结课明细表
以下权限新增学生结课明细表
- 教师主管:教务与成本管理—学生结课明细表
- 学管专员/学管主管:报表—学生结课明细表
- 分校长:报表—学生结课明细表
- 总校长/全国总学管 新增:学生结课统计表;学生结课明细表;路径:报表—学生结课统计表(Tab页切换展示结课统计表/结课明细表)
优化逻辑:
【语种】:若该学生一个/多个签约是一个语种,只展示一个语种;若该学生存在多个签约且签约了不同的语种,则该字段展示多个语种
【结课时间】: 修改前逻辑:目前是从签约维度出发,取值是最后一节课教务确认上课的时间
修改后逻辑:从学生维度出发,首先校验该学生是否存在多个签约,若学生只有一个签约,则取最后一节课教务确认上课的时间。若学生有多个签约,则比较多个签约课程上课时间,取课程时间在最后的这节课教务确认上课的时间
数据说明:默认展示当月数据,可筛选展示其他时间段的数据
导出EXCEL:列表页面不展示课时数字段,导出表格时需导出课时数
页面需求:若该学生已结课,则学生信息页增加显示结课时间
# ⚙️ 功能优化
教务权限:教务确认上课交互优化
增加校验和交互提示:进入列表默认校验签约总财务是否确认到账
一对一列表:进入列表默认校验该签约总财务是否确认到账,是则按规则正常展示确认上课/申请确认上课,否则鼠标移到确认上课/申请确认上课显示:总财务暂未确认到账
一对二/一对多列表:进入列表默认校验该班课中所有签约总财务是否确认到账,是则按规则正常展示确认上课/申请确认上课,否则鼠标移入确认上课/申请确认上课显示具体的签约号:签约号XXXX/XXXX总财务暂未确认到账,签约号按实际校验数据去展示
操作列显示优化:课程状态为已结束,确认上课为已确认的数据,操作列直接显示查看,无需收进更多操作中
教务/教师权限:排课日历查询组件优化
筛选逻辑变动:排课日历筛选条件增加包含逻辑
实现功能:能够同时查看多个老师的排课日历
功能入口:教务—教务管理—排课日历 教师专员/教师主管—我的课程—课程日历
# 🐞 BUG修复
修复超学签约退费总财务审核变更学员状态逻辑问题
修复不需要选择顾问的学生转移校区后添加回访报错问题